    On demand:MBAM,Hitman Pro,(Minor infection or check for possible infection)
    Emsisoft Emergency Kit,Norman Malware Cleaner,Dr.Web Cure IT(Quite heavily infected)
    Bitdefender and Avira rescue disk.(Heavily infected and unbootable PC due to malware)
